使用Redis缩减数据库延时(redis3)
随着网络技术的发展和普及,互联网用户的数量也在不断增加,数据库性能瓶颈随之而来。现代Web应用中,为了满足性能,实现超快响应时间,开发者可能不得不增加成本购买更多硬件,或者发现其他简化流程的方法。Redis是一种高性能的内存键值数据库,在Web应用中可以用来减少数据库延时,提高整体性能。
首先,Redis可以将部分数据存储在内存中,而不是将所有数据都存储在数据库中。从而有效地减少数据库的访问延时,更有效地缩减数据库延时。例如,对于需要经常访问的数据,将其存储在Redis中,而不是每次都要从数据库中读取,可以大大降低访问延时,从而改善Web应用的响应速度。
此外,使用Redis还可以提高处理流程的效率。通常,一个Web应用至少会有一个前端和一个后端,两个开发者之间需要合作完成任务。但是,一旦前端发给后端的参数量较大,后端可能需要额外的时间来处理任务,这会导致系统的延时增加。而Redis可以将部分数据存储在内存中,而不是每次都必须从数据库中读取,从而减少处理流程的延时。
最后,在使用Redis时,应该注意Redis客户端程序的选择。当将部分数据存储在Redis中时,用户如何调用和使用Redis就变得非常重要。此外,不同的Redis客户端程序可能具有不同的特性,根据不同的需要,可以选择最合适的Redis客户端程序,以提高Redis存储的效率和减少数据库延时。
Redis是当下一种非常流行的内存键值数据库,具有高效的存储和读取效率,可以有效减少数据库的访问延时,帮助Web应用程序提高性能。如果要使用Redis缩减数据库延时,应该注意正确灵活选择Redis客户端程序以及配置内存参数,以便最大程度地发挥Redis的性能。